如何删除服务器中的服务

worktile 其他 362

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    删除服务器中的服务可以通过以下步骤进行操作:

    1. 登录服务器:使用SSH或远程桌面等工具登录到目标服务器。

    2. 停止服务:首先,需要停止正在运行的服务。使用以下命令之一来停止服务:

      • 对于Linux系统,使用systemctl stop 服务名命令,例如systemctl stop httpd
      • 对于Windows系统,使用net stop 服务名命令,例如net stop w3svc
    3. 禁用服务:为了确保服务不会在服务器启动时自动启动,需要将其禁用。使用以下命令之一来禁用服务:

      • 对于Linux系统,使用systemctl disable 服务名命令,例如systemctl disable httpd
      • 对于Windows系统,使用sc config 服务名 start= disabled命令,例如sc config w3svc start= disabled
    4. 删除服务:最后,删除服务的相关文件。这些文件通常位于服务器的特定目录中,例如/etc/systemd/system(对于Linux系统)或C:\Windows\System32(对于Windows系统)。使用以下命令之一来删除服务文件:

      • 对于Linux系统,使用rm /etc/systemd/system/服务名.service命令,例如rm /etc/systemd/system/httpd.service
      • 对于Windows系统,使用sc delete 服务名命令,例如sc delete w3svc

    请注意,执行操作时需要具有足够的权限。如果没有足够的权限,请使用管理员账户或联系系统管理员进行操作。

    此外,删除服务器中的服务是一项敏感操作,要确保删除的服务确实不再需要,并且备份相关文件以防万一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在服务器上删除服务可以通过以下几个步骤来完成:

    1. 停止服务:在删除服务之前,首先需要停止该服务的运行。可以使用以下命令来停止服务:

      systemctl stop <service_name>
      
    2. 禁用服务:停止服务后,需要禁用该服务以防止其在启动时自动运行。可以使用以下命令来禁用服务:

      systemctl disable <service_name>
      
    3. 删除服务文件:服务文件通常位于 /etc/systemd/system/ 目录下。可以使用以下命令来删除该服务的服务文件:

      rm /etc/systemd/system/<service_name>.service
      
    4. 重新加载 Systemd 配置:删除服务文件后,需要重新加载 Systemd 配置,使其生效。可以使用以下命令来重新加载 Systemd 配置:

      systemctl daemon-reload
      
    5. 删除服务相关文件:除了服务文件外,还可能存在与服务相关的其他文件,如日志文件、配置文件等。可以使用以下命令来删除这些文件:

      rm -rf /var/log/<service_name>/
      rm -rf /etc/<service_name>/
      

    请注意,删除服务前请确保已经备份相关数据和文件,以免误操作导致数据丢失。此外,删除服务可能会影响服务器的正常运行,因此请谨慎操作并确保了解服务的用途和作用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    删除服务器中的服务需要执行以下步骤:

    1. 查看服务器上的服务列表
      首先,需要查看服务器上安装的服务列表,可以通过命令行或者图形界面来执行。在Windows系统上,可以使用命令 "services.msc" 打开服务管理器,或者使用命令 "sc query" 查看服务列表。在Linux系统上,可以使用命令 "systemctl list-unit-files" 查看服务列表。

    2. 停止要删除的服务
      在删除服务之前,需要先停止该服务。在Windows系统上,可以在服务管理器中选择要停止的服务,右键点击选择“停止”。在Linux系统上,可以使用命令 "systemctl stop [service-name]" 来停止服务。

    3. 禁用服务
      在停止服务之后,可以选择禁用该服务,以防止其在系统启动时自动启动。在Windows系统上,可以在服务管理器中选择要禁用的服务,右键点击选择“属性”,然后将启动类型设置为“禁用”。在Linux系统上,可以使用命令 "systemctl disable [service-name]" 来禁用服务。

    4. 删除服务文件
      删除服务文件是彻底删除服务的一个重要步骤。在Windows系统上,服务文件通常位于 Windows 目录的 System32 目录下,以 .exe 或 .dll 结尾。在Linux系统上,服务文件通常位于 /etc/systemd/system 或者 /etc/init.d 目录下。可以使用命令 "rm [service-file-path]" 来删除服务文件。

    5. 删除服务注册项(可选)
      在Windows系统上,一些服务可能会在注册表中有相关的注册项。如果需要彻底删除服务,可以使用注册表编辑器来删除相关注册项。在注册表中,服务相关的注册项通常位于 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services 下。在删除注册项之前,建议先备份注册表。

    6. 重启服务器
      删除服务后,建议重启服务器以确保变更生效。

    需要注意的是,在删除服务器中的服务之前,建议先备份相关文件和注册表项,以防止意外情况发生。此外,删除服务可能会导致某些功能受影响,建议在删除之前确保了解服务的作用和影响,并谨慎操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部